Personal profile

Biography

I am anEconomic Geographer lecturing at the University of Galway since 2012. Prior to that I was a researcher at the Whitaker Institute where mywork looked at the location decisions of multinational tech companies. More recently, I haveturned my attention to Creative Economies and Cultural Production. Through a number of EU funded projects, I havesought to better understand the relationship between culture, creativity and production as well as identifying the unique role played by Geography. I contributed to both of Galways designation of UNESCO City of Film and European Capital of Culture. I havepublished over 30 internationally peer reviewed journal articles and three books. I amDirector of the newly formed UrbanLab Galway at the University of Galway. My newest book `Galway: Making a Capital of Culture was published by Orpen Press in 2023.

Research Interests

As an economic geographer, I am interested in the spatial distribution of wealth. How we legislate for the uneven distribution of resources is a common theme in my work. I have published on the location decisions of multinational corporations and in doing so moved the focus beyond financial incentives (in the form of tax relief) to the innate qualities of the places they invest in. In exploring that I have begun to switch my focus on how we make places. Foremost here is the role that Culture plays in an increasingly globalised world. Through a number of projects (Creative Edge, Galways bid for European Capital of Culture) I have been better able to explore the role that Culture plays in the socioeconomic well being of particular places.I have an interest in spatial dispersion of innovative practices. My current projects the SFI funded Cathair Shamhlú: Platform Urbanism and the Horizon Europe funded INSITU project look at the role of culture and creativity in place making as well as exploring spatial computing for firing the geographic imaginary.
